Client Audit Specialist (PBM) - Remote

Primetherapeutics
Posted 11 hours ago
🇺🇸United States🏠Remote💰$66.0K–$106.0K📁Legal & Compliance
Is this job info correct?

At Prime Therapeutics (Prime), we are a different kind of PBM, with a purpose beyond profits and a unique ability to connect care for those we serve. Looking for a purpose-driven career? Come build the future of pharmacy with us. Job Posting Title Client Audit Specialist (PBM) - Remote Job Description As a member of the Client Audit Management (CAM) team, the Client Audit Specialist is accountable for independently, or in collaboration with senior staff or compliance leader, managing regulatory and/or client-initiated audits. The Specialist is responsible for evaluating and understanding the purpose of various audit types and the related deliverables, developing a holistic understanding of the audit management process, and managing the end-to-end audit activities. This position seeks and obtains additional expertise as indicated from respective Compliance and Operational subject matter experts to meet applicable regulatory, client, and/or functional audit expectations. Responsibilities Review and interpret assigned audit requests to determine scope, impacted business areas and stakeholders, and evidence necessary to fulfill and manage the audit request Present sample cases or evidence data for assigned processes and act as a subject matter expert for business requirements, system specification, process flows, process change, Federal and/or State regulations and/or accreditation standards implications Develop and maintain key internal and external stakeholder relationships to effectively provide audit consultation, streamline work activity, create/drive efficiencies, and ensure consistent, timely, and accurate audit completion, reporting, or submission of deliverables Monitor audit progress and proactively identify and mitigate risks (including performance guarantee implications) to audit completion; appropriately escalate to Audit Advisors, department leadership or operational stakeholders and provide remediation recommendations to prevent delays or future findings Perform quality reviews and analysis of audit deliverables to ensure compliance with contractual and regulatory requirements Ensure stakeholders have a thorough understanding of their audit-related responsibilities, are accountable to producing deliverables accurately and on time, and are informed of relevant audit status updates or changes Ensure thorough audit records are developed and maintained, with emphasis on accuracy, relevance, and timeliness; prepare necessary documentation for audit activities including deliverables, reports, findings and recommendations; provide clear and concise audit result communications to internal and external stakeholders Integrate project management and organization capabilities by effectively communicating and leading audit strategy, deliverables, requirements, milestones and accountability, throughout the entire audit Support department enhancement initiatives to ensure accurate and thorough training and procedural materials are available and maintained Other duties as assigned ​ Minimum Qualifications Bachelor's degree in Business, Health Care Services or related area of study, or equivalent combination of education and/or relevant work experience; HS diploma from an accredited school or equivalent GED is required 2 years of relevant work experience in audit, compliance or operations within a regulated environment Must be eligible to work in the United States without the need for work visa or residency sponsorship Additional Qualifications Effective verbal and written communication, and presentation skills; ability to effectively distill complex information into clear and compelling presentations and leadership briefings Strong interpersonal skills, with the ability to effectively facilitate meetings, resolve conflict, build consensus, establish rapport and collaborate effectively across departments, internally and externally, and at all levels within an organization; ability to confidently represent the business and interact with external entities Demonstrated critical thinking and analysis skills, with proven ability to navigate ambiguous, complex and challenging situations while maintaining professionalism, tact, and empathy Organization and prioritization skills, strong attention to detail, and the ability to simultaneously manage multiple, complex projects, under pressure and strict timeframes, without compromising quality Agility and adaptability to change and navigate in a demanding, dynamic, fast-paced, intense, and matrix environment Ability to use independent judgment and critical decision making in the analysis of audit processes and evidence Intermediate to Advanced skills in Microsoft Office Suite (Word, Excel) Preferred Qualifications Health insurance/PBM operations and/or contract audit experience Experience with regulatory compliance for Medicare/Medicaid/Commercial or ACA drug benefit Project management experience Every employee must understand, comply with and attest to the security responsibilities and security controls unique to their job, and comply with all applicable legal, regulatory, and contractual requirements and internal policies and procedures Every employee must be able to perform the essential functions of the job and, if requested, reasonable accommodations will be made to enable employees with disabilities to perform the essential functions, absent undue hardship. In addition, Prime retains the right to change or assign other duties to this job. Potential pay for this position ranges from $66,000.00 - $106,000.00 based on experience and skills.
